#65c44d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65c44d is composed of 39.6% red, 76.9%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 107.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 53.5%. #65c44d color hex could be obtained by blending #caff9a with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#65c44d color description : Moderate lime green.
#65c44d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65c44d has RGB values of R:101, G:196,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6669389.

Shades and Tints of #65c44d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#65c44d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868d84 is the less saturated color, while #44fb16 is the most saturated one.
